Transaction 143d20d6b9f421031e3095ad3495d1ebcf7e1deb921ca9162da601e555cec766

1 Input
2 Outputs
  • 143d20d6b9f421031e3095ad3495d1ebcf7e1deb921ca9162da601e555cec766:0
  • value  31805615
    address  3M1jaoFftJGi3Ti9xrqDoZ97hBPs7ASpR8
  • 143d20d6b9f421031e3095ad3495d1ebcf7e1deb921ca9162da601e555cec766:1
  • value  67109265
    address  1DCBxWHQ65HrZ54riDnNPYegnvp7JnRj92